Rafizi or Izzah? Each contributed in their own way: PKR Youth chief

Let members exercise their wisdom and decide to ensure continuity and strengthen the organisation, says Muhammad Kamil Munim

12:00 PM MYT

 

KUALA LUMPUR – The two contenders for the PKR deputy presidency in the upcoming party polls, Datuk Seri Rafizi Ramli and Nurul Izzah Anwar, each bring undeniable strengths and contributions to the party. 

Speaking to Scoop, newly appointed PKR Youth chief Muhammad Kamil Abdul Munim said that while both candidates have their own strengths and weaknesses, these should not be used by any camp to attack those offering themselves for service. 

“Some believe that Nurul Izzah’s strengths are well-suited for the party at this point in time, particularly in uniting members and preventing internal divisions. 

“She has experience in supporting the party and leading election campaigns, among others. 

“Others acknowledge that Rafizi, too, is experienced and has contributed significantly to the party. 

“So if one believes Nurul Izzah’s strengths are what the party needs now, they should campaign based on that to move PKR forward. 

“Likewise, if one believes Rafizi has what it takes, use that strength to rally support for him,” he said today. 

Kamil (pic) has said that party members can make their own decisions when asked about Rafizi’s remarks during his nationwide tour. – Bernama pic, May 17, 2025

Asked whether Rafizi’s open remarks during his nationwide tour might affect his support and chances of retaining the deputy presidency, Kamil said party members are capable of making their own assessments. 

“I believe the grassroots understand how to evaluate the conduct and credibility of the current leadership. 

“So let’s trust the wisdom of members to make the best choice (in this election) to ensure the party’s continuity and to further strengthen the organisation,” he added. 

All eyes will be on Johor Bahru next week, where the central party leadership election is set to take place on May 23, with Rafizi defending his deputy president post against challenger Nurul Izzah. 

Nurul Izzah is the current PKR vice-president, appointed to the position in 2022. – May 15, 2025
